What is Social Media Marketing?
Social media marketing refers to the process of using social media platforms to connect with an audience, build a brand, increase website traffic, and drive sales. It involves creating and sharing content on social media networks, engaging with followers, running paid ads, and analyzing the results of your efforts to improve future campaigns.
Social media marketing allows businesses to directly communicate with their audience in a more personal and engaging way compared to traditional forms of advertising. By creating valuable content and fostering meaningful interactions, businesses can strengthen their brand presence, enhance customer loyalty, and generate leads and conversions.
Why Social Media Marketing is Essential for Digital Marketing
Increased Brand Awareness
One of the key advantages of social media marketing is its ability to increase brand awareness. With billions of users on social media platforms, businesses have the chance to reach a vast audience. Social media allows companies to promote their products, services, and values in front of potential customers who may not have encountered them otherwise.
By creating and sharing engaging content, businesses can increase their visibility and expose their brand to new audiences. Whether through organic content, paid ads, or viral posts, social media enables companies to reach users who are actively engaging with the platform.
According to a survey by HubSpot, 91% of businesses with an active social media presence report increased brand visibility. By optimizing social media profiles, using relevant hashtags, and creating shareable content, brands can make a lasting impression and expand their reach.
Engagement and Relationship Building
Social media marketing is not just about broadcasting promotional messages; it’s about building relationships with your audience. Social media platforms allow businesses to engage in two-way conversations with customers, respond to inquiries, and address concerns in real time.
Engagement is a crucial aspect of social media marketing, as it helps build trust and loyalty among followers. Responding to comments, sharing user-generated content, running polls or quizzes, and hosting live sessions are great ways to engage with your audience. When businesses actively engage with their followers, they can establish a more personal connection, making customers feel valued.
This engagement fosters a sense of community and encourages followers to become brand advocates, which can lead to increased word-of-mouth referrals and recommendations.
Targeted Advertising
Another major benefit of social media marketing is the ability to run highly targeted advertising campaigns. Social media plat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and LinkedIn provide robust ad targeting features that allow businesses to reach specific demographics based on age, location, interests, behaviors, and more.
Paid social media ads can be used to promote specific products, services, or content to a highly targeted audience, ensuring that your marketing dollars are spent efficiently. For example, Facebook Ads allows advertisers to segment their audience into different groups and serve tailored ads to each group based on their characteristics or actions.
This targeted approach ensures that businesses are reaching the right people with the right message, increasing the chances of generating quality leads and conversions. Social media ads are also measurable, allowing businesses to track performance in real time and optimize campaigns for better results.
Improved Customer Insights
Social media platforms provide valuable insights into customer behavior and preferences. By tracking metrics such as likes, shares, comments, and click-through rates, businesses can learn what type of content resonates with their audience and what doesn't.
These insights allow businesses to refine their social media strategy, creating more relevant and effective content. Additionally, by monitoring competitor activity and industry trends, companies can stay ahead of the curve and adapt to changes in the market. Social listening tools also allow businesses to track brand mentions, feedback, and sentiment, which can be useful for improving products or services.
The feedback from social media interactions provides companies with an opportunity to understand customer pain points, preferences, and desires, which can inform product development and marketing strategies.
Drive Traffic to Your Website
Social media marketing is an excellent way to drive traffic to your website. By sharing engaging content, product announcements, blog posts, or promotions on social media, businesses can encourage followers to visit their website for more information or to make a purchase.
Including clear calls to action (CTAs) in your social media posts, such as “Learn More” or “Shop Now,” can entice followers to click through to your site. Social media platforms like Instagram and Facebook also allow businesses to include links in their bio, posts, and stories, making it easy to drive traffic to landing pages, product pages, or blog articles.
The more engaging and relevant your content is on social media, the more likely your audience will click on links and visit your website, increasing the potential for conversions and sales.
Cost-Effective Marketing
Social media marketing offers a cost-effective way to promote your brand, especially when compared to traditional forms of advertising like TV, radio, or print. While paid ads can require a budget, the costs of creating and sharing organic content on social media are relatively low.
Even without a large advertising budget, businesses can leverage the power of organic social media marketing. Posting valuable content, engaging with followers, and building relationships doesn’t have to cost much. Moreover, the potential reach and impact of social media make it an attractive option for businesses of all sizes, from startups to large enterprises.
For small businesses or startups with limited budgets, social media provides an opportunity to compete with larger competitors and build an online presence without the need for substantial financial investment.
Enhanced Customer Support
Social media platforms provide businesses with an opportunity to offer customer support in real time. Social media channels are often used as customer service platforms where customers can reach out for assistance, ask questions, or report issues.
By providing quick responses to customer inquiries, businesses can enhance their reputation for customer service and demonstrate that they value their customers. Social media allows companies to address customer concerns before they escalate, turning potentially negative experiences into positive ones.
Many businesses use tools like chatbots or dedicated support teams to manage customer queries on social media platforms, ensuring that their followers receive timely assistance.
Best Practices for Social Media Marketing
To maximize the impact of social media marketing, businesses should follow a few key best practices:
Know Your Audience: Understanding your audience’s interests, demographics, and behaviors is key to creating content that resonates with them.
Create Engaging Content: Content should be visually appealing, informative, and aligned with the interests of your audience. Use images, videos, polls, and other interactive content to boost engagement.
Post Consistently: Consistency is key to maintaining visibility on social media. Regularly post content and engage with your followers to keep your brand top of mind.
Leverage Hashtags: Using relevant hashtags can increase the reach of your posts and help potential customers discover your content.
Monitor Analytics: Track the performance of your posts and ads to understand what works and what doesn’t. Use insights to adjust your strategy and improve results.
Use Paid Advertising: If your budget allows, invest in paid social media ads to reach a larger, targeted audience and drive traffic to your website.
Engage with Your Audience: Respond to comments, messages, and feedback. Building a community around your brand is essential for long-term success.
